Each Trans-Pacific" Empresa connects at Vancouver with a Special Mail Express Tralo and at Quebec with Atlantic Mail Steamer as shown above... The Empress of Britain" and Empress of Ireland" are magnificent vancis of 14,500 tons, Speed io Knots, and are regarded as second to none on the Atlantic. The" Empress" Steamers on the Pacific and on the Atlantic are equipped with the Marconi wireless apparatus.
Passengers booked to all the principal points in Canada, the Calted States and Europe, also Around the World.
HONGKONG TO LONDON, ist Class, via Qanadian Atlantic Port or New York (Includ ing Meals and Berth in Sleeping Car while crossing the American Continant by Osnadian Pacific direct Line)..............................
Passengers for Europe have the option of going forward by any Trans-Atlantic Lina either from Ganadian Porta or from New York or Boston.
SPECIAL THROUGH RATES (First Class only) are granted to Missionaries, Members of the Naval, Military, Diplomatic and Civil Services of China and Japan Governments.
Through Passengers are allowed Stop over privileges at the various points of interest
roufe.
R.M.S." MONTEAGLE" carries only One Class" of Saloon Passengers (termed Inter mediate) the accommodation and commissariat being excellent in every way.

STEAM TO CANTON.
THE New Twin Screw Sto! Atamers
[607
* KWONG TUNG" „Üapt. E. W. WALKER "KWÔNG SAI" ......Capt. E. S. GROWE,
Laira Hongkong for Canton mi, g every jovaning, (Saturday excepted).
Leave: Canton for Hongkong al ́530_avory avaning."(Busday sucépted)..
-
These fine Steamers, owned by Chinese capitalists and Officered, by Europaans, are second to none on the River. Excellent accommodation for eighteen First Class Pas- sengers. The Steamers are lit throughout by Electricity, - Electric Fans in Slate Rooms.
